Why the map you grew up with disagrees

On a Mercator map, area grows with distance from the equator. Samoa sits at about 14°S and is stretched to 1.06× its true area; Venezuela at 7° N is stretched to 1.02×. Here the two are distorted about the same amount, so Mercator gets this pair roughly right. The figure above uses the Equal Earth projection, where every square kilometre is drawn the same size.
